Aetiology and Pattern of 122 Patients With Mandibular Condylar Fracture

This retrospective observational study aimed to investigate the aetiology and fracture patterns among patients with mandibular condylar fractures (MCF) who were treated at a trauma center in Shiraz, Iran, between 2018 and 2020. A total of 122 patients were included. The study involved collecting data on fracture characteristics, including anatomical location, classification (MacLennan and Loukota systems), angle of fracture lines, and the presence of concomitant maxillofacial injuries. The objective was to examine correlations between these characteristics and demographic or clinical factors such as age, sex, and mechanism of injury.

About this study

This is a retrospective cohort study conducted at a major trauma center affiliated with Shiraz University of Medical Sciences, Iran. The study enrolled patients diagnosed with unilateral or bilateral mandibular condylar fractures between January 2018 and December 2020. Data were extracted from clinical records and radiographic evaluations. Fractures were classified according to the MacLennan and Loukota systems, and relevant demographic and injury-related information was recorded. No interventions were administered as part of this registry. All procedures were conducted under approval from the institutional ethics committee. The primary aim was to investigate patterns in fracture characteristics and their associations with trauma mechanisms and patient demographics.

Inclusion criteria

  • Patients diagnosed with unilateral or bilateral mandibular condylar fracture
  • Trauma-related fracture confirmed by clinical and radiographic evaluation
  • Complete medical record and imaging data available
  • Age between 12 and 65 years at the time of trauma

Exclusion criteria

  • History of prior mandibular condylar fracture
  • Incomplete medical or imaging records
  • Patients younger than 12 or older than 65 at time of injury

Primary outcomes

  1. Distribution of mandibular condylar fracture types (MacLennan classification)

    Time frame: At initial evaluation (2018-2020)

    Frequency and percentage of fracture types (Class I-IV) based on MacLennan classification at initial clinical evaluation.

  2. Anatomical location of mandibular condylar fractures

    Time frame: At initial evaluation (2018-2020)

    Distribution of fracture sites: subcondylar, condylar neck, or condylar head based on CT scan classification (Loukota system).

  3. Etiology of mandibular condylar fractures

    Time frame: At initial evaluation (2018-2020)

    Proportion of fractures attributed to road traffic accident, falling, or assault based on patient report.
